Atlanta SOA Protester Gets 100 Days in Federal Prison

By Jonathan Springston, Senior Staff Writer, Atlanta Progressive News (February 16, 2007)

(APN) ATLANTA – An Atlanta activist received a sentence of 100 days in a federal prison on January 29, 2007, after being arrested and charged with a Class B misdemeanor November 19, 2006, at a protest at the School of the Americas (SOA). The notorious SOA–recently renamed WHINSEC, the Western Hemisphere Institute for Security Cooperation–is located next to the Fort Benning Military Reservation in Columbus, Georgia.

Mike Vosburg-Casey, a 32-year-old activist with the Open Door Community in Atlanta, was one of 16 protestors from across the US arrested at the annual School of the Americas Watch (SOAW) protest, after “crossing the line” onto the Fort Benning Military Reservation.

“It’s unreasonable for the Judge to be sentencing us to any jail time at all,” Vosburg-Casey told Atlanta Progressive News. “This is constitutionally protected speech we shouldn’t be sentenced to prison time for this.”
